Ilhéus weather in August

In August, Ilhéus sees average daytime highs of 25°C and overnight lows near 21°C, with 70 mm of rain across 17.7 wet days and about 11.5 hours of daylight. It is the 11th-warmest and 11th-wettest month of the year here.

Day-to-day highs hold fairly steady near 25°C through the month. The sky is clear or mostly clear about 39% of the time in August, and the air most often feels muggy.

Daylight stretches from about 11 h 18 min at the start of August to 11 h 42 min by month's end. Set against the rest of the year, August is Ilhéus's 3rd-clearest and 5th-windiest month. For the whole year in context, see Ilhéus's year-round climate.

Temperature in August

Average highAverage lowShaded bands: 10–90% of days

Day-to-day highs hold fairly steady near 25°C through the month.

A typical August day in Ilhéus reaches about 25°C in the afternoon and slips back to 21°C overnight — a 3°C spread between the day's warmth and the night's chill. On most days the high lands between 24°C and 26°C. Set against its neighbours, August runs on par with July and on par with September.

Sea temperature near Ilhéus in August

The nearest coast averages about 25°C in August — the other half of the beach question. The full-year curve and swim-comfort zones are below.

The sea at the nearest coast (about 19 km away) is warmest in March at about 28°C and coldest in August near 25°C.

The water stays above 20°C all year — warm enough for a swim any month.

UV index in Ilhéus in August

LowModerateHighVery highExtreme

Clear-sky midday UV in August peaks around 9 (very high — sun protection essential). The full-year curve, shaded by WHO exposure level, is below.

Under clear skies, the midday UV index in Ilhéus peaks around February 18 at about 15 (extreme) — sunscreen, a hat and midday shade are essential. It bottoms out near June 22 at about 8 (very high).

The index reaches 3 or more — the level where the WHO recommends sun protection — every month of the year.

Location & terrain

Where is Ilhéus?

Ilhéus sits at 14.8°S, 39.0°W, in Brazil. The nearest listed city is Itabuna, 27 km away.

Topography around Ilhéus

How much the land rises and falls, and what covers it, within 3, 16 and 80 km of Ilhéus.

Within 3 km, the terrain around Ilhéus has only modest vari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 72 m around an average of 7 m above sea level; within 16 km, only modest vari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 181 m; within 80 km, large vari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 1,034 m.

The land around Ilhéus is covered by water (55%) and artificial surfaces (22%) within 3 km, water (54%) and trees (40%) within 16 km, and trees (51%) and water (32%) within 80 km.
